摘要
A method for determining the functional state of the sympathetic nervous system in the cervical spine in patients with vertebral cerebrovascular insufficiency, consists in the fact that the impact of the current 150-250 mA to the skin in the area of the cervical spine on the right and left paravertebral lines and secondary lines, fix maximum intensities current projections in the skin on the right and left side of the spinous processes of the level and under the spinous processes of the cervical vertebrae, the current figures are summed, and then calculating the average value of all received in the cervical spine region of current values according to the formula :, gdeA - mean value of all received current indicators in the field of cervical spine; ΣI- sum of the current strength in all cutaneous projections; n - number of tested skin in the cervical region of the projections spine (n = 21), and if the average value of the current in the cervical spine is within the range of 115-125 mA, conclude normal sympathetic maintenance of the cervical spine, and if the secondary receptacle chenie current in the cervical spine is in the range 126-139 pA, it is determined "Increased sympathetic effect in the cervical spine mild severity", and if the average value of the current in the cervical spine is in the range 140- 158 mA, it is determined "Increased sympathetic effect in the cervical spine moderate severity," and if the mean value of the current in the cervical spine is in the range 159 mA or more, it is determined
